Question 693129: Jim has taken 5 tests and his average is 84, if he gets a 100%, a perfect score on his next three text what will be his new average?

The average grade is the sum of grades divided by the number of grades. Your student has an 84 (out of 100) average for 5 grades, so the sum of the first five grades is
(1) sum = 5*84 or
(2) sum = 420
Now when the student scores 100 on each of the next three tests his new sum is
(3) new sum = 420 + 100 + 100 + 100 or
(4) new sum = 720
Now he has 8 grades, so his/her new average is
(5) new average = 720/8 or
(6) new average = 90
Answer: The student's new average will be 90%.
